How do I pull Data from stock to Excel?
Simply select the cells that contain the stock names/ticker symbols and navigate to the Data tab in the Excel Ribbon. Next click the Stocks button within the Data Types group. After clicking the Stocks button, Excel will attempt to convert as many of the selected cell's values into stock data types.

Where does Excel get stock Data from?
Office 365 subscribers will notice a new Stocks data type appearing on the Excel data tab. With it, you can get current data from the internet related to companies from 60 different stock exchanges around the world. Using formulas, you can keep track of their latest stock price, trading volume, and other information.
How do you automatically update stock prices in Excel?
Excel will refresh the stock quotes at any time. One way to do this is to use the Data > Refresh All command. Another way is to right-click any of the company names and select Refresh, or, Data Type > Refresh.
Does Excel have a history log?
In Microsoft Excel, you cannot revert the worksheet back in time by undoing changes like you can do in Microsoft Word. Excel's Track Changes is rather a log file that records information about the changes made to a workbook. You can manually review those changes and choose which ones to keep and which ones to override.
Does Excel have cell history?
The history lists everything in your worksheet that has been changed, including the old value (previous cell content) and the new value (current cell content). Save your workbook. From the Review tab, click the Track Changes command, then select Highlight Changes from the drop-down menu.
How do I create a history sheet in Excel?
From the Review tab, click the Track Changes command, then select Highlight Changes from the drop-down menu. The Highlight Changes dialog box will appear. Check the box next to List changes on a new sheet, then click OK. The tracked changes will be listed on their own worksheet, called History.

What is a market data vendor?
A financial data vendor provides market data to financial firms, traders, and investors. The data distributed is collected from sources such as stock exchange feeds, brokers and dealer desks or regulatory filings (e.g. an SEC filing).
What is financial market data?
Market data refers to the live streaming of trade-related data. It encompasses a range of information such as price, bid/ask quotes and market volume. Trading venues provide reports on various assets and financial instruments, which are then distributed to traders and firms.
